Two politicians are exposed in sex acts

September 06, 2019

Videos showing two male politicians engaging in sex with women have been posted online to their embarrassment, with many Iranians saying the tapes expose not only the two men but also the hypocrisy of the regime itself.

Neither of the men is a major figure.  Both are Reformists.

The first sextape was posted online August 4, according to France24, the international arm of French state broadcasting. The four-minute video, which was clearly filmed with a hidden camera, shows Ali Mohammad Ahmadi — the former governor general of Kohgiluyeh va Boyer Ahmad, a province in southwestern Iran — having sexual relations with a woman.

Local media outlets, said to have close ties to Ahmadi, alleged the politician had been set up by a foreign intelligence agency that wanted to force him to travel to Canada to take part in a television program critical of the Iranian government.

Those same media outlets claimed Ahmadi refused and that the video was leaked as a result. A close associate of Ahmadi swore the woman in the video was his “legitimate wife under Islamic law.”  But France 24 said Ahmadi has been married to the same woman for years, and she was definitely not the woman who appeared in the sextape.

Two days later, a second video of Ahmadi with the same woman was posted online. In that eight-minute video, the pair spend most of the time talking and kissing.

Shortly afterwards, Iranian social media users identified the woman as working for an Iranian airline.

Ahmadi was appointed to his post by the government of President Rohani. Ahmadi recently resigned from his position as governor general to start campaigning in the February 2020 legislative elections.

On August 9, another leaked sextape popped up on social media, this time featuring a different politician — Abbas Malekzadeh, the mayor of Sadra, a city of about 100,000 residents in the southern province of Fars.  Four days earlier, he had been arrested with three members of the City Council, all accused of corruption.

Unlike the videos of Ahmadi, which looked like they were filmed with a hidden camera, Malekzadeh filmed this video himself. In the video, he stands naked, caressing a naked woman as she talks on the telephone.

In the days following, the woman in the video posted two videos begging social media users to erase the sextape. She says it was filmed three years ago and could “ruin [her] life” as she is now married.

Other photos of Malekzadeh have recently appeared online. In these images, he is seen smoking a hookah with a woman named Zahra Jamali, one of his assistants at the City Council, who was arrested with Malekzadeh August 5.

An Iranian female journalist spoke to France24 about how Iranians have reacted to these sextapes.

“People see these videos as just more proof of government officials’ hypocrisy,” she said. “These men have the right to have sexual relations, of course, and most people don’t really care whom they do it with,… but the men in question are officials of the Islamic Republic, a country with a morality police that arrests people for dating out of wedlock.”

Men in the regime have not been known to suffer much punishment for sexual offenses.   In 2007, the prosecutor general announced that Reza Zarei, the chief of police in Tehran, had been arrested in a brothel with six women. He spent four months in prison before being demoted and given early retirement.
